Courtyard House
Kuala Lumpur | Malaysia
Private Dwelling | Completed | 2024
This multi-generational house in Malaysia is shaped by Peranakan heritage and the courtyard traditions of Straits townhouses. The design reinterprets these precedents through a contemporary family home that supports shared living across generations.
Courtyards and open voids link the floors vertically, allowing light, air, and daily life to move freely through the house. These connections strengthen relationships between generations while maintaining a sense of openness and calm.
Malaysian culture is expressed through materiality and lifestyle. Natural finishes, crafted details, and climate-responsive spaces celebrate local living patterns, creating a home that is both rooted in tradition and attuned to modern family life.

Stepped House
Chandigarh | India
Private Dwelling | Concept Design | 2023
A private family dwelling that has been designed for a multi-generational family in Chandīgarh, India.
The architecture draws from traditional Indian living patterns that value shared space and daily connection.
Private rooms sit alongside open courtyards and shared areas, creating a clear balance between privacy and togetherness. The house is simple, rooted, and enduring — a contemporary home built on timeless Indian values.
Indian craft and local materials are integral to the design. Handcrafted elements, natural finishes, and tactile surfaces ground the home in its cultural context.

Centre of Performing Arts
Tel Aviv| Israel
Cultural Centre| Concept Design | 2022
This performing arts centre is conceived as a dynamic cultural landmark. A tessellated façade wraps the building, creating a strong geometric identity that shifts with light and movement.
Lined with dichroic film, the façade transforms both inside and out. As daylight changes, surfaces refract colour, animating the exterior while casting vibrant reflections into the interior spaces. The building becomes an ever-changing backdrop for performance.
Architecture and atmosphere work together to heighten the experience of art. The result is a centre that is not static, but performative in itself: responding to light, time, and human presence.
